Ryan Foster awarded SEPnet Bursary
Friday 25 June 2010
Ryan Foster, Level 2 MPhys student, has been awarded a SEPNet Bursary to research High Energy and Particle Physics at Queen Mary University of London for an 8-week summer experimental/academic internship this year. Specifically this project will use the techniques developed at the existing B-Factories to identify an interesting decay channel and modify the SuperB software in such a way as is appropriate in order to study the potential to make measurements that may elucidate new physics (i.e. physics beyond the standard model).
Ryan's supervisor at Queen Mary University of London is former Surrey MPhys Graduate Dr. Adrian Bevan.
